Problem 16-70 (Static) (Appendix) Recording Costs in a Standard Costing System (LO 16 -7)

The standard cost sheet for Chambers Company, which manufactures one product, follows.

Direct materials, 40 yards at $2.00 per yard $ 80
Direct labor, 5 hours at $20 per hour 100
Factory overhead applied at 80% of direct labor
(variable costs = $60; fixed costs = $20) 80
Variable selling and administrative 64
Fixed selling and administrative 40
Total unit costs $ 364

Standards have been computed based on a master budget activity level of 28,800 direct labor-hours per month. Actual activity for the past month was as follows.

Materials used 228,000 yards at $2.05 per yard
Direct labor 25,200 hours at $20.40 per hour
Total factory overhead $ 444,000
Production 5,000 units

Assume there are no beginning inventories or ending inventories. All production was sold for $2,375,000.

Required:

Prepare the journal entries to record the activity for the last month using standard costing. Assume that all variances are closed to Cost of Goods Sold at the end of the month. (If no entry is required for a transaction/event, select "No journal entry required" in the first account field.)

A. Record the actual costs of direct Materials incurred.

B. Record the actual costs of direct labor incurred.

C. Record the transfer of overhead applied to work-in-process inventory.

D. Record the actual costs of overhead incurred.

E. Record the overhead applied to production and variances, if any.

F. Record the transfer of WIP inventory to finished goods.

G. Record the sale of all goods.

H. Record the cost of all goods.

I. Record the disposition of variances.
